Quick answer: Multiply PSI by 0.0689476 to get bar. 1 psi ≈ 0.069 bar, and 1 bar ≈ 14.504 psi. So typical car tire pressure of 32 psi = 2.21 bar, and road bike pressure of 100 psi = 6.89 bar.

PSI (pounds per square inch) is the pressure unit used in the United States for tires, air compressors, and plumbing. Bar is the metric equivalent, used across Europe, in meteorology, and in most engineering and industrial contexts. The conversion is simple multiplication, but understanding which unit your gauge uses — and what range is correct for your application — is what keeps tires properly inflated and hydraulic systems safe.
Formula: PSI to Bar
The definition: 1 bar = 100,000 pascals (Pa). One psi = 6,894.76 Pa. Dividing: 6,894.76 ÷ 100,000 = 0.0689476 bar per psi. For quick mental math, use 1 psi ≈ 0.069 bar — the error is less than 0.01%.
Reverse: bar to psi
Approximately: multiply bar by 14.5 to get psi. A European tire sticker saying 2.5 bar = 2.5 × 14.5 = 36.25 psi.
Car and Truck Tire Pressure Guide
Correct tire pressure improves fuel economy, handling, and tire life. The recommended pressure is on a sticker inside the driver's door jamb (not on the tire sidewall, which shows the maximum rated pressure).
| Vehicle type | Typical front (psi) | Front (bar) | Typical rear (psi) | Rear (bar) |
|---|---|---|---|---|
| Compact car (e.g., Toyota Corolla) | 32–35 psi | 2.2–2.4 bar | 32–35 psi | 2.2–2.4 bar |
| Mid-size sedan (e.g., Honda Accord) | 32–36 psi | 2.2–2.5 bar | 32–36 psi | 2.2–2.5 bar |
| SUV / crossover | 33–38 psi | 2.3–2.6 bar | 33–38 psi | 2.3–2.6 bar |
| Light truck / pickup | 35–45 psi | 2.4–3.1 bar | 50–65 psi | 3.4–4.5 bar |
| Electric vehicles (heavier) | 38–45 psi | 2.6–3.1 bar | 38–45 psi | 2.6–3.1 bar |
| Spare (full-size) | Same as regular | — | — | — |
| Compact spare ("donut") | 60 psi | 4.1 bar | — | — |
Bicycle Tire Pressure Chart
Bike tire pressure varies enormously by type and rider weight. Unlike car tires, the "correct" pressure for a bike is more of a range than a single figure.
| Bike type / tire | Typical range (psi) | In bar | Notes |
|---|---|---|---|
| Road bike (23–25 mm tire) | 90–120 psi | 6.2–8.3 bar | Higher for lighter riders; tubeless runs lower |
| Road bike (28–32 mm tire) | 70–90 psi | 4.8–6.2 bar | Common on gravel/endurance bikes |
| Gravel bike (35–45 mm) | 40–65 psi | 2.8–4.5 bar | Lower for rougher terrain |
| Mountain bike (2.2–2.4 in) | 25–35 psi | 1.7–2.4 bar | Tubeless: 22–30 psi common |
| Mountain bike (2.5+ in) | 18–28 psi | 1.2–1.9 bar | Enduro / downhill use |
| Hybrid / city bike | 50–70 psi | 3.4–4.8 bar | Efficiency on pavement |
| BMX | 55–110 psi | 3.8–7.6 bar | Varies by discipline |
| E-bike (heavier) | 35–50 psi | 2.4–3.4 bar | Check manufacturer recommendation |
Other Pressure Uses: Weather, Hydraulics, Scuba
Atmospheric / weather pressure
Standard atmospheric pressure (sea level) is 1 atm = 1.01325 bar = 14.696 psi. Weather stations report pressure in millibars (mbar) or hectopascals (hPa), where 1 mbar = 1 hPa. Normal sea-level pressure is about 1,013 mbar. Storms drop below ~990 mbar (≈ 14.36 psi); high-pressure fair weather is above 1,020 mbar (≈ 14.8 psi).
Hydraulic systems
| Application | Typical working pressure | In psi | In bar |
|---|---|---|---|
| Home water mains | Normal supply | 40–80 psi | 2.8–5.5 bar |
| Pressure washer (residential) | — | 1,200–2,000 psi | 83–138 bar |
| Hydraulic car jack | — | ~1,000 psi | ~69 bar |
| Industrial hydraulics | — | 1,000–5,000 psi | 69–345 bar |
| Espresso machine | — | ~130 psi | ~9 bar |
| CO₂ cartridge (airsoft) | — | ~900 psi | ~62 bar |
Scuba diving
Scuba tanks are filled to 200–300 bar (2,900–4,350 psi). Dive regulators drop this to a breathable ~9–15 bar (130–218 psi) at the first stage, then to ambient pressure at the second stage. A full aluminum 80 cylinder holds about 3,000 psi (207 bar); divers surface with a minimum of 500 psi (34 bar) reserve.
Full PSI to Bar Table
| psi | bar | psi | bar |
|---|---|---|---|
| 1 psi | 0.069 bar | 40 psi | 2.76 bar |
| 2 psi | 0.138 bar | 45 psi | 3.10 bar |
| 5 psi | 0.345 bar | 50 psi | 3.45 bar |
| 10 psi | 0.689 bar | 60 psi | 4.14 bar |
| 14.5 psi | 1.00 bar | 65 psi | 4.48 bar |
| 14.696 psi | 1.013 bar | 70 psi | 4.83 bar |
| 15 psi | 1.034 bar | 80 psi | 5.52 bar |
| 20 psi | 1.379 bar | 90 psi | 6.21 bar |
| 25 psi | 1.724 bar | 100 psi | 6.89 bar |
| 28 psi | 1.931 bar | 120 psi | 8.27 bar |
| 30 psi | 2.069 bar | 150 psi | 10.34 bar |
| 32 psi | 2.207 bar | 200 psi | 13.79 bar |
| 35 psi | 2.413 bar | 250 psi | 17.24 bar |
| 36 psi | 2.482 bar | 300 psi | 20.68 bar |
| 38 psi | 2.620 bar | 500 psi | 34.47 bar |
FAQs About PSI to Bar
How do I convert PSI to bar quickly?
Multiply PSI by 0.069 (or more precisely, 0.0689476). For a rough check: divide PSI by 14.5. So 35 psi ÷ 14.5 ≈ 2.41 bar. The mental shortcut "divide by 14.5" is accurate to within 0.03%.
Is 2.2 bar the same as 32 psi?
Almost — 2.2 bar = 31.9 psi (2.2 × 14.504), which rounds to 32 psi. This is a very common car tire pressure, and 2.2 bar is the European equivalent you'll see on stickers in countries that use bar.
What is 1 bar in PSI?
1 bar = 14.5038 psi. Standard atmospheric pressure is 1.01325 bar = 14.696 psi. So 1 bar is very close to — but slightly below — atmospheric pressure at sea level.
My European tire sticker says 2.5 bar — how many psi is that?
2.5 bar × 14.504 = 36.3 psi. Round to 36 psi when inflating with a US-style gauge. Always check the door jamb sticker for your specific vehicle — it may specify front and rear pressures separately.
What's the difference between PSI, bar, kPa, and atm?
All are pressure units measuring force per area. 1 atm (atmosphere) = 1.01325 bar = 101.325 kPa = 14.696 psi. The bar is convenient because it's close to 1 atm. kPa is the strict SI unit. PSI is used mainly in the US and UK. You'll see all four depending on the industry and country.
What PSI should a football (soccer ball) be?
FIFA regulations specify 8.5–15.6 psi (0.6–1.1 bar) for a standard football. The NFL specifies 12.5–13.5 psi (0.86–0.93 bar) for American footballs. NBA basketballs: 7.5–8.5 psi (0.52–0.59 bar).
